weigy

2020年JVM面试题记录

--JVM基本原理--

--JVM启动流程--

---Java对象创建过程---

https://www.cnblogs.com/weigy/p/12654806.html

--JVM内存模型--

https://www.cnblogs.com/weigy/p/12613058.html

--JVM常用参数设置--

https://www.cnblogs.com/weigy/p/12579283.html

--JVM如何调优--

https://www.cnblogs.com/weigy/p/12399018.html

--如何定位JVM性能问题--

--如何变避免JVM内存泄漏、溢出--

https://www.cnblogs.com/weigy/p/12315662.html

-- 内存溢出和内存泄漏的区别、产生原因以及解决方案--

https://www.cnblogs.com/weigy/p/12315660.html

--JVM的内存空间--

-- Java 内存区域(运行时数据区)--

https://www.cnblogs.com/weigy/p/12657038.html
--JVM的GC机制--

--JVM类(JVM类字节码)加载机制----

https://www.cnblogs.com/weigy/p/12602537.html

--类加载的时机--

--类的编译过程--

--JVM堆和栈的概念和区别--

--JVM垃圾回收策略和算法有哪些--

--JVM内存区域,哪些是内存共享,哪些是私有的--

--什么是垃圾回收--

--如何判断对象是否存活--

 使用可达性分析算法  来判断 对象  是否 存活。

--jvm怎么判断哪些对象应该回收--

https://www.cnblogs.com/weigy/p/12604941.html

--你知道java里面有哪几种引用--
--谈到了可达性分析算法,那如果在该算法中被判定不可达对象,一定会被回收吗?--
--垃圾回收器和他们的工作过程--
--谈到了根节点,那哪些对象可以作为根对象--

 

分类:

技术点:

相关文章: